At a certain college, 30% of the students major in engineering, 20% play club sports, and 10% both major in engineering and play club sports. A student is selected at random.

a) What is the probability that the student is majoring in engineering?

b) What is the probability that the student plays club sports?

c) Given that the student is majoring in engineering, what is the probability that the

student plays club sports?

d) Given that the student plays club sports, what is the probability that the student is

majoring in engineering?

e) Given that the student is majoring in engineering, what is the probability that the

student does not play club sports?

f) Given that the student plays club sports, what is the probability that the student is not

majoring in engineering?

Answer and Explanation

The venn diagram for the question is in the attachment.

Percentage majoring in engineering = 30% = 0.3

Percentage that plays club sport = 20% = 0.2

Percentage that major in engineering and play sport = 10% = 0.1

Percentage majoring in engineering & do not play club sport = 30 - 10 = 20% = 0.2

Percentage that plays club sport & do not major in engineering = 20 - 10 = 10% = 0.1

Total percentage = 100%

a) probability that student is majoring in Engineering P(E) = 30/100 = 0.3

b) probability that student plays club sport = 20/100 P(S) = 0.2

c) probability that the

student plays club sport given that the student is majoring in engineering, P(S|E) = (P(E and S))/(P(E))

P(E and S) = 10/100 = 0.1, P(E) = 0.3

P(S|E) = 0.1/0.3 = 0.3333

d) probability that the

student is majoring in engineering given that the student plays club sport, P(E|S) = (P(S and E))/(P(S))

P(S and E) = 10/100 = 0.1, P(S) = 0.2

P(E|S) = 0.1/0.2 = 0.5

e) probability that the

student does not play club sport given that the student is majoring in engineering, P(S'|E) = (P(E and S'))/(P(E))

P(E and S') = 20/100 = 0.2, P(E) = 0.3

P(S'|E) = 0.2/0.3 = 0.667

f) probability that the

student is not majoring in engineering given that the student plays club sport, P(E'|S) = (P(S and E'))/(P(S))

P(S and E') = 10/100 = 0.1, P(S) = 0.2

P(E|S) = 0.1/0.2 = 0.5

Write multiple if statements: If carYear is before 1967, print "Probably has few safety features." (without quotes). If after 19
Free_Kalibri [48]

Answer:

The solution code is written in Python 3.

  1. carYear = 1995
  2. if(carYear < 1967):
  3.    print("Probably has few safety features.\n")
  4. if(carYear > 1970):
  5.    print("Probably has head rests. \n")
  6. if(carYear > 1991):
  7.    print("Probably has electronic stability control.\n")
  8. if(carYear > 2002):
  9.    print("Probably has airbags. \n")

Explanation:

Firstly, create a variable, <em>carYear</em> to hold the value of year of the car make. (Line 1)

Next, create multiple if statements as required by the question (Line 3-13). The operator "<" denotes "smaller" and therefore <em>carYear < 1967</em> means any year before 1967. On another hand, the operator ">" denotes "bigger" and therefore <em>carYear > 1970 </em>means any year after 1970.

The print statement in each of the if statements is done using the Python built-in function <em>print()</em>. The "\n" is an escape sequence that create a new line at the end of each printed phrase.

Write a method printShampooInstructions(), with int parameter numCycles, and void return type. If numCycles is less than 1, prin
kirill [66]

Answer:

// The method is defined with a void return type

// It takes a parameter of integer called numCycles

// It is declared static so that it can be called from a static method

public static void printShampooInstructions(int numCycles){

// if numCycles is less than 1, it display "Too few"

   if (numCycles < 1){

       System.out.println("Too few.");

   }

// else if numCycles is less than 1, it display "Too many"

    else if (numCycles > 4){

       System.out.println("Too many.");

   }

// else it uses for loop to print the number of times to display

// Lather and rinse

  else {

       for(int i = 1; i <= numCycles; i++){

           System.out.println(i + ": Lather and rinse.");

       }

       System.out.println("Done");

       

   }

}

Explanation:

The code snippet is written in Java. The method is declared static so that it can be called from another static method. It has a return type of void. It takes an integer as parameter.

It display "Too few" if the passed integer is less than 1. Or it display "Too much" if the passed integer is more than 4. Else it uses for loop to display "Lather and rinse" based on the passed integer.
